Correspondent Shikha in Conversation with Human Rights Activist, Hiralal Pahadia

On Human Rights Day, we got in touch with an activist who is fighting against exploitaion and solving problems of his community for over a decade.

Meet Hiralal Pahadia, a human rights activist from Jharkhand who has been working with the Pahadia community since 2005. He is using his voice to expose human rights voilations and corruption in government policies.

Community Correspondent Shikha Pahadin got an opportunity to interview Hiralal Pahadia, about his work, community and his idea of Human Rights.

Video by Community Correspondent Shikha Pahadin.
